LLM을 효과적으로 활용하기 위한 Prompt 작성법 🎯
오늘은 AI 기술에 대한 전문 코딩 지식이 없어도, Prompt(프롬프트)를 잘 작성해서 대규모 언어 모델(LLM, Large Language Model)을 효율적으로 활용하는 방법을 알아보겠습니다. AI 모델은 우리가 어떤 식으로 질문하고, 어떤 배경 정보를 제공하느냐에 따라 결과물의 질이 완전히 달라지므로, 비개발자라도 꼭 알아두면 좋은 팁들이 있습니다.
1. Prompt란? 🤔
LLM에게 무엇을 어떻게 물어볼지 ‘지시’해주는 입력 문장(또는 문장 집합)을 Prompt라고 합니다.
- 🔹 개념 요약
Prompt는 'AI에게 줄 질문 또는 상황 설명'이라고 보면 됩니다. - 🔹 실생활 예시
예를 들어, 여행사 직원에게 전화를 걸어서 “제가 내년에 파리로 신혼여행을 가고 싶은데, 3박 5일 추천 코스와 대략적인 비용을 알려주세요.”라고 말하면,- 어디를 가는지(파리)
- 얼마나 머무는지(3박 5일)
- 무엇이 궁금한지(추천 코스와 비용)
를 한 번에 전달하는 셈입니다.
AI에게도 마찬가지로, 질문 + 배경 정보 + 원하는 답변 형식을 합쳐서 제공해야 정확한 답변을 얻을 수 있습니다.
- 🔹 문제를 해결하는 방식
Prompt 안에 “내가 해결하고 싶은 문제의 배경”과 “어떤 형태의 정보를 원하는지”를 명확히 담으면, AI가 중요한 정보를 정확하게 추론해내기 쉬워집니다.
2. 어떻게 동작하나요? 🎬
1) 기본 개념
- AI 모델(예: ChatGPT, GPT-4 등)은 방대한 양의 텍스트 데이터로 학습되어 있어, 사람이 제공하는 Prompt를 바탕으로 가장 적절하다고 판단되는 답변을 조합해 냅니다.
- Prompt가 구체적일수록 모델이 ‘아, 이런 내용을 원하는구나’ 하고 명확히 이해하게 됩니다.
2) 실제 적용 예시
[사용자]
"안녕하세요, 저는 IT와 전혀 상관없는
마케팅 분야에서 일하고 있습니다.
다음 주에 회사 임직원 대상 '디지털 마케팅' 관련 교육을 해야 하는데,
추천할 만한 핵심 주제 5가지만 뽑아주시고,
각 주제가 왜 중요한지 짧게 설명해 주세요."
- 배경 정보: “마케팅 분야에서 일하고 있음”, “임직원 대상 디지털 마케팅 교육”
- 궁금한 것: “핵심 주제 5가지 + 각 주제의 중요성 간단 설명”
- 요청 형식: 한 번에 요약된 리스트 형태
이를 통해 AI 모델은 사용자가 원하는 정보(디지털 마케팅 핵심 주제 & 이유)를 체계적으로 제공할 수 있습니다.
🚀 동작 원리
- 문맥 파악: LLM은 Prompt에서 사용된 키워드와 문장 구조를 분석하여, 어떤 맥락인지 이해합니다.
- 지식 및 패턴 활용: 학습된 방대한 데이터(뉴스, 서적, 논문, 웹문서 등)를 바탕으로, 가장 관련성 높은 내용을 찾아냅니다.
- 형식에 맞춰 답변 생성: 사용자 요구(예: 5가지 리스트, 짧은 요약 등)에 맞춰 글을 재구성합니다.
3. 효과적인 Prompt 작성법 🌟
비개발자라면 다음과 같은 요소들을 고려해 Prompt를 작성해보세요.
- 역할(Role) 지정
- AI 모델이 어떤 ‘역할’을 맡게 할지 명시하면, 더 전문성 있는 답변이 나옵니다. 예: “당신은 10년 차 인사(HR) 전문가입니다. 우리 회사의 채용 프로세스를 개선하려면…”
- 상황 또는 배경(Context) 제공
- “우리 회사는 스타트업이고, 직원은 50명 정도입니다.”와 같이 AI가 놓인 맥락을 먼저 제시하면, 더 적합한 조언이 가능합니다.
- 구체적인 질문(Goal) 제시
- “디지털 마케팅 교육에서 꼭 다뤄야 할 5가지 주제와, 각 주제의 중요성을 알려주세요.”처럼 명확하고 구체적으로 질문하세요.
- 원하는 답변 형식(Format) 명시
- 예: “간단한 리스트 형태로 정리해 주세요.”, “각 포인트마다 2~3줄씩 구체적인 예시를 들어주세요.”
- 비개발자도 결과물이 어떤 모습이어야 하는지 직접 설정해주면 효율적입니다.
- 추가 정보 요청 또는 제한 사항
- “너무 전문용어는 자제하고, 일반 직장인도 이해할 수 있는 언어로 설명해 주세요.”
- “대답은 300자 이내로 요약해 주세요.” 등의 요청도 가능합니다.
4. 주의할 점 ⚠️
- 과도한 기대
- AI 모델이 만능은 아닙니다. Prompt가 불완전하면 불분명한 답변이 돌아올 수 있습니다.
- 맥락 부족
- “회사에 대해 아무런 정보를 주지 않고, 우리 회사에 맞춰 세일즈 전략을 짜달라”고 하면 모델이 추론하기 어렵습니다. 기본 정보를 충분히 제공해야 합니다.
- 너무 광범위한 질문
- “마케팅은 어떻게 해야 하나요?”는 애매모호한 질문입니다.
- 구체적으로 “SNS 마케팅에서 인플루언서를 활용하는 전략은?”처럼 범위를 좁히면 훨씬 효과적인 답변을 얻습니다.
- 민감한 정보 오남용
- 회사 내부 문서나 개인 정보 등을 넣는 경우, 정보 유출 위험이 있을 수 있습니다. AI 모델에게 중요한 비밀 정보를 직접 노출하지 않도록 주의하세요.
5. 간단한 Prompt 예시 📱
1) 신규 프로젝트 아이디어 브레인스토밍
"당신은 시장 트렌드 분석 전문가입니다.
우리 회사는 최근 20~30대 여성 소비자를 대상으로
건강 간식 브랜드를 론칭했습니다.
신규 프로젝트 아이디어 3가지를 제안해주시고,
각 아이디어의 시장성 평가와 예상 리스크를 알려주세요."
- 역할: 시장 트렌드 분석 전문가
- 배경: 20~30대 여성 대상 건강 간식 브랜드
- 구체적 요청: 프로젝트 아이디어 3가지 + 시장성 평가 + 리스크
2) 팀 소통 방식 개선
"당신은 10년 차 조직개발(OD) 컨설턴트입니다.
우리 팀은 현재 원격근무가 늘어나면서
팀원 간 커뮤니케이션 문제가 잦아지고 있습니다.
원격근무 시 팀 소통 효율을 높이기 위한 3가지 방안을
단계별로 정리해 주세요.
- 역할: 조직개발 컨설턴트
- 배경: 원격근무/커뮤니케이션 문제
- 요청 형식: 단계별(1, 2, 3) 아이디어
6. 실제 사용 시 팁 ✔
- Prompt에 질문을 여러 번 쪼개서 쓰지 말고, 한 문단에 깔끔하게 요약하되, 반드시 필요한 정보는 빠짐없이 적습니다.
- 추가 후속 질문을 하거나, ‘좀 더 자세한 예시를 들어주세요’라고 물어보면 AI 모델이 연속된 대화 맥락을 이어서 더 구체적으로 답변할 수 있습니다.
- 비개발자라고 하더라도, 조직 내 정보, 주요 현황 등을 Key Point로 정리해서 Prompt에 포함하면, 더 맞춤형 답변을 얻을 수 있습니다.
7. 마치며 🎁
코딩 지식이 없더라도, Prompt 작성 스킬만 있다면 AI 모델을 강력한 업무 파트너로 삼을 수 있습니다. 오늘 소개한 간단한 지침을 기억해 두면, 회의 자료 준비부터 기획, 아이디어 브레인스토밍, 팀 운영 등 다양한 업무에서 도움을 받을 수 있을 것입니다.
"어떤 역할을 맡기고, 어떤 배경을 제시하고, 어떤 답을 원하는지를 구체적으로 표현하자!"
이 한 문장만 기억해도, Prompt 작성의 핵심을 꽤 잘 이해한 것입니다.
참고 자료 및 출처
- OpenAI 공식 문서 및 Prompt Engineering 가이드
- 비즈니스 사례를 중심으로 한 AI 활용 세미나 자료
- “Prompt Engineering for Non-technical Professionals” 온라인 강의
비개발자에게도 AI의 문은 활짝 열려 있습니다. Prompt를 잘 다루는 능력은 디지털 시대의 새로운 ‘문해력’이 될 가능성이 매우 큽니다. 꾸준히 연습해보면서, 자신의 분야에 AI를 더 효율적으로 활용해 보세요!